Aunt gets 5 years in deadly Chicago fire

The aunt of two children who died in a Chicago apartment fire has been sentenced to five years in prison.

Authorities said 22-year-old Britany Meakens pleaded guilty Friday to two felony counts of child endangerment. Judge Diane Cannon sentenced her. Prosecutors said Britany Meakens and 23-year-old Tatiana Meakens left four children alone in an apartment with space heaters and a hot plate while they went to a party.

Two-year-old Javaris Meakens and 3-year-old Jariyah Meakens died in the December blaze. The coroner said both children died from carbon-monoxide intoxication and inhaling smoke and soot.

Tatiana Meakens is the mother of the children who died. She is awaiting trial and held in the Cook County jail.
